Our process for handling privacy complaints differs from the three-step process described on our previous page for complaints about products and services offered by the Bank.

At the Bank, privacy complaints are handled by the employees who receive them or their designated team. If you remain dissatisfied with the response to your complaint, our employees will offer you the opportunity to contact the Privacy Office to request a review.

Step 2 : Request a review of my complaint

Did you already submit a complaint, but it was not resolved to your satisfaction? You can request a review of your complaint by the Client Complaint Appeal Office.

To request a review of your complaint, complete the form below. Alternatively, you may call the Client Complaint Appeal Office at 1-888-300-9004.

Although your request cannot be made anonymously, we assure you that it will be treated confidentially.

Before submitting your complaint, please read and accept the following terms and conditions.

By contacting the Client Complaint Appeal Office, I consent to the opening of my file upon receipt. I understand that my cooperation is essential to the review of my complaint. By submitting my complaint, I agree to:

  • Provide any information and documentation relevant to the analysis of my complaint that may be requested.
  • Have an open and honest dialogue in good faith.
  • Maintain a polite, respectful and courteous attitude.
  • Keep confidential all discussions and information exchanged between me, the Client Complaint Appeal Office and National Bank while my complaint is being processed and after I am informed in writing of its conclusion.
  • Receive correspondence about my complaint through the email address I provide on this form.

I understand that, at any time, the Client Complaint Appeal Office:

  • May interrupt its analysis or decide to close my file without conclusion, if it deems that a lack of cooperation or the use of offensive, violent or discriminatory language or behaviour is detrimental to the process underway or to the reputation, integrity or safety of its employees.
  • Will cease all correspondence by email regarding my complaint if I request it in writing and therefore, if required, I will have to go to the branch of my choice to retrieve my documents.
  • Will retain all documents relating to my complaint for the period prescribed by the oversight body responsible for the complaint handling process.
